How they compare

Grenada currently reports 110.9% against 98.6% in Small states, a difference of 12.3%.

That makes Grenada's figure about 1.1 times Small states's.

Across all 14 years both countries report, Grenada has been ahead every year.

Grenada ranks 21st and Small states ranks 21st of 188 countries.

Grenada has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Total female enrollment in primary and lower secondary education, regardless of age, expressed as a percentage of the female population of official primary and lower secondary education age. GER can exceed 100% due to the inclusion of over-aged and under-aged students because of early or late school entrance and grade repetition.
